Output 0753bdd9ef3326d4c80eee7c587a7aac28861da84f52e1fb7e58a34fce242217:554

value
18886
script pubkey
OP_0 OP_PUSHBYTES_20 e984e2ac0b1f86913fe25dcb3471a263eb8baad5
address
bc1qaxzw9tqtr7rfz0lzth9ngudzv04ch2k4sr73eq
transaction
0753bdd9ef3326d4c80eee7c587a7aac28861da84f52e1fb7e58a34fce242217
spent
true